About Hotel Central

Hotel Central is centrally located on the main promenade near the shopping area in the Indian city of Gangtok.

Hotel Specifications

Accommodation

Hotel Central has 28 well-appointed air-cooled rooms that are replete with modern facilities and help the guests to relax and rejuvenate themselves.

Dining

The multi-cuisine restaurant of Hotel Central offers sumptuous Indian, Chinese, Continental, and Sikkimese cuisines. The well-stocked bar of the hotel promises to keep your spirits soaring.

Conference and Banquet Facilities

The hotel also offers 2 halls for holding conferences and hosting banquets. The larger hall can accommodate 70 pax and the smaller hall is ideal for 20 pax.

City Information

All good things in life come in small packets and Gangtok is a good illustration. Be it the rich flora, the beautiful people, or the serene Buddhist monasteries, this small town, occupies an important position in the itinerary of tourists in search of tranquility from the humdrum of modern life.

One of the oft-visited sites of Gangtok is the Namgyal Institute of Centralology. It was built in 1958 and is a research center for Mahayana Buddhism and Centralan culture. Besides being a museum of traditional and old artifacts, one can also buy Buddhist religious books and other objects of craft. Nearby is a gompa for young lamas. The Tsuk-La-Khang or Royal Chapel is the main place of worship and assembly for the Buddhists and is huge repertoire of religious relics. It is open during the Losar festival. Another important monastery is the Enchey Gompa and is worth a visit during the festival season of January to February.

Adjacent to the Namgyal Institute is the Orchid Sanctuary, which is the home of some 500 varieties of orchids. There is a larger orchid sanctuary called Orchidarium, off the main road to Rangpo. Near White Hall, there is a Flower Exhibition Center and seasonal flowers, bonsai and orchids are a delight to the eyes. From April to June and September to November, one can come here.
